CSKA Moscow head coach Dimitris Itoudis opened up about the possibility of taking over the national team of Greece.

Itoudis confirmed he is in talks with the Greek Basketball Federation, but there is still no agreement.

“I’m taking the opportunity to say that I’m honored and proud that the new president of Greek Federation is thinking to me. But I have to say that right now we’re talking and it’s not only a decision by my side.

It’s a decision that has also to involve a great club and a great president. We’re now in talks to find a solution. I would like to be the new head coach of Greece but we need to find the way. I need to know the calendar and all the aspects. Let’s see and how things will go,” Itoudis told BasketInside’s Matteo Andreani.

The Greek coach also revealed he has received offers from other European national teams, too. Dimitris Itoudis is under contract with CSKA Moscow until 2023.
